Famous for its stunning harbor, scenic mountains, and world-renowned beef, Kobe is a city that offers families a perfect blend of urban adventure and natural beauty. Known as one of Japan’s most international cities, Kobe’s charm lies in its mix of historical influences, from European-style neighborhoods to traditional Japanese culture. Families can stroll through the picturesque Kitano district, ride the Shin-Kobe Ropeway for breathtaking mountain views, or enjoy a waterfront day at Meriken Park.
Having explored Kobe’s many neighborhoods, Luca & Nico love its laid-back yet dynamic atmosphere. For younger travelers, Kobe offers exciting interactive experiences, such as the Anpanman Children’s Museum and the Kobe Animal Kingdom, where kids can interact with animals in an immersive setting. Food lovers will enjoy trying Kobe beef, savoring fresh seafood, or visiting local bakeries that showcase Kobe’s unique fusion of cultures. With its friendly atmosphere and a perfect mix of city life and nature, Kobe is a must-visit destination for families.
